Moving to Round Rock looks like a financial upgrade — better income-to-cost ratio.
Round Rock has a cost index of 104 vs 97 for St Paul. Round Rock is 7 points more expensive overall. Monthly rent goes from $1,485 to $1,593 (+7%).
If you earn the St Paul median of $73,055, you would need approximately $78,327/year in Round Rock to maintain equivalent purchasing power, based on the cost index difference of 7 points (7%).
Median rent in St Paul is $1,485/month. In Round Rock it is $1,593/month — a difference of +$108 per month, or $1,296 per year.
